Citizens can also take part via paper forms available in libraries and community centres.The budget consultation is taking place after elected members previously considered the Council's budget strategy and financial outlook which identified a funding deficit of £8.4m for next year. It is noted this deficit may increase if the Council is unable to reduce the level of overspend in the current financial year on a recurring basis or further cost pressures emerge before next year.Any final gap will require to be made up from efficiencies, additional income including government grants or an increase in local Council Tax. The estimated gap is before any agreed increase in Council tax, where for each 1% added to the current charge, the Council would expect to generate additional income of £700,000 each year.
